John Peel (Disambiguation)
There are many people with the name
John Peel
:
John Peel
(John Ravenscroft, 1939-2004) was a British broadcaster and radio personality.
John Peel (farmer)
was a huntsman, the subject of the 18th century song
D'ye ken John Peel?
.
John Peel (writer)
is a writer of science-fiction books.
Sir William John Peel
(1912-2004) was a British politician.
